Route Optimization is a method used in waste management to plan the most efficient paths for garbage trucks and collection vehicles. It's like creating a 'smart map' that helps drivers collect waste while using the least amount of time, fuel, and resources. Companies use special software to determine the best routes, considering factors like traffic, vehicle capacity, and collection schedules. This helps save money on fuel, reduces overtime hours, and ensures all customers get reliable service. Think of it as similar to how delivery companies plan their routes, but specifically for waste collection needs.

Q: How would you handle a major route restructuring project across multiple districts?
Expected Answer: Should discuss experience managing large-scale changes, considering factors like customer communication, driver training, and gradual implementation to minimize disruption.
Q: What metrics would you use to measure the success of route optimization?
Expected Answer: Should mention fuel costs, overtime reduction, customer complaints, on-time collection rates, and vehicle maintenance costs as key performance indicators.
Q: How do you balance efficiency with customer service when planning routes?
Expected Answer: Should explain how to maintain consistent pickup times while maximizing efficiency, and handling special customer requests within optimized routes.
Q: What factors do you consider when planning seasonal route adjustments?
Expected Answer: Should discuss weather conditions, seasonal waste volume changes, holiday schedules, and how to adjust routes accordingly.
Q: What basic factors do you consider when planning a collection route?
Expected Answer: Should mention truck capacity, distance between stops, traffic patterns, and collection time windows as basic considerations.
Q: How would you handle an unexpected road closure affecting a planned route?
Expected Answer: Should demonstrate basic problem-solving skills for rerouting vehicles and communicating changes to drivers and customers.
